John Wensink To Coach For the Remainder of the Season

March 30, 2004 - International Hockey League 2 (IHL 2)
Missouri River Otters News Release


Missouri River Otters assistant coach John Wensink will take over the team's head coaching duties from Lonnie Loach for the remainder of the season.

Loach has been given a personal leave of absense for the remainder of the season.

Wensink played in the National Hockey League for six seasons, including four with the Boston Bruins. His best season came in 1978-79, when he scored 28 goals, registered 18 assists, and stockpiled over one hundred penalty minutes.
